We've actually discussed at length whether or not to use this repo as a forum for also deploying to Kubernetes (and, indeed, there are manifests for deploying the application itself to Kubernetes).
However, there is already good documentation for doing this which point to the relevant Helm charts, such as for Tempo here.
We could potentially produce a Helm chart that deploys all of the components in this repository, but the worry is due to the number of moving parts this would be a fairly heavy maintanance workload (though saying that, we could potentially use some GH actions to automatically generate dependency updates). We would, though, have to keep updates in-line with the Docker Compose manifests, and some of the versioning we have is due to changes in functionality and therefore is occasionally staggered with mainline releases.
I think we'll reopen some discussion internally on this and make a yes/no decision in the (fairly) near future.
